双系统 安装XP后再安装2000.doc_第1页
双系统 安装XP后再安装2000.doc_第2页
双系统 安装XP后再安装2000.doc_第3页
双系统 安装XP后再安装2000.doc_第4页
双系统 安装XP后再安装2000.doc_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

双系统安装XP后再安装2000的方法安装了Windows XP的操作系统。可是最新发现有一个重要应用程序目前只能支持Windows2000,于是准备装一个Windows XP2000的双系统。笔者曾经在Widnows XP下成功安装过Windows XP98的双系统(用Window98启动盘启动到DOS下,直接安装Windows98即可),于是想当然的就使用Windows2000的光盘启动盘进行安装。安装完以后,发现仅仅只能启动Windows2000而Windows XP却不能启动了。怎么回事情呢?静下心来分析一下,原来Windows 2000和Windows XP的内核虽然几乎一样(都是使用NT的内核),但是其系统引导文件的版本不一样,而Windows 2000在安装的时候启动文件(ntldr、)覆盖了,所以引起了Windows XP无法启动。而Windows 98的引导文件和Windows XP的引导文件不一样,所以对Windows XP的引导文件不会破坏。Windows XP的引导文件是向下兼容的,也就是说能既能引导Windows 98又能引导Windows 2000,因此只要将Windows XP光盘中的i386目录的ntldr和覆盖到C:下的文件就可以恢复双系统启动了。注意:这个时候虽然能启动,但多系统启动菜单是英文的,将Bootfont.bin覆盖到c:下就可以恢复中文菜单了。xp与2000双系统的安装假设你的Windows XP安装在C盘,你想安装Windows 2000到D盘,那么只要用Windows 2000的光盘启动系统,直接运行安装程序并安装到D盘就可以,只不过这样安装后双启动菜单会失效,只能进入Windows 2000。原因是这样的:在Windows NT系统的启动中,用到了很多重要的系统文件,而在安装了XP的机器上再装2000的时候会把XP的NTLDR和NTDETECT.COM两个文件替换为Windows 2000中版本较低的同名文件,而Windows 2000中的这两个文件是不能引导Windows XP的。因此我们的修复也就是用Windows XP中的文件替换被Windows 2000覆盖的该文件。这两个文件都保存在C盘的根目录下,不过他们有默认的隐含、系统和只读属性,因此你不能用一般的方法替换,而首先要解除他们的隐含、系统和只读属性。方法是这样的:进入到Windows 2000中,在运行中分别输入attrib c:ntldr s r hattrib c: s r h每行输入完成后按下回车键。这时你已经完全的解除了这两个文件的系统、隐含和只读属性。现在从Windows XP的安装光盘的I386文件夹中复制这两个同名的文件出来到C盘根目录,并覆盖原文件。这时你的双启动菜单就已经恢复了。不过安全起见我们可以把那两个文件隐藏起来,方法是,在运行中分别输入:attrib c:ntldr +s +r +hattrib c: +s +r +h这样会重新赋予那两个文件系统、隐含和只读属性。重启动一下看看吧,你的双启动菜单已经完全正常了WinXP下安装Win2000在安装好Windows XP之后,再安装Windows 2000比安装98或ME要简单得多。本文所说的方法也不用第三方的软件,而且可以在FAT32 或NTFS的文件格式上进行操作。1.首先,打开“控制面板”,选择“文件夹选项”并双击,在“文件夹选项”窗口中选择“查看”,在“高级设置”中将“隐藏受保护的操作系统文件”前的“”去掉,以显示我们所需要的两个系统文件:“NTLDR”和“NTDETECTCOM”;2.将以上两个文件拷贝到一张软盘中;3.修改BIOS中的启动选项以从光盘启动电脑,并运行Windows 2000的安装操作程序;4.按正常方法安装Windows 2000;5.安装完成后,将电脑启动到Windows 2000;6.将我们拷贝到软盘中的以上两个文件拷贝到C区根目录;如果系统提示不能拷贝,用户需要修改以上两个文件的属性,去掉它们的“只读”和“隐藏”等属性。明:我们这儿所以这样做是因为Win XP版本的“NTLDR”和“NTDETECTCOM”支持启动Windows 2000,但是后者并不支持启动到前者,所以我们需要进行以上操作。假设你的WindowsXP安装在C盘,你想安装Windows2000到D盘,那么只要用Windows2000的光盘启动系统,直接运行安装程序并安装到D盘就可以,只不过这样安装后双启动菜单会失效,只能进入Windows2000。原因是这样的:在WindowsNT系统的启动中,用到了很多重要的系统文件,而在安装了XP的机器上再装2000的时候会把XP的NTLDR和NTDETECT.COM两个文件替换为Windows2000中版本较低的同名文件,而Windows2000中的这两个文件是不能引导WindowsXP的。因此我们的修复也就是用WindowsXP中的文件替换被Windows2000覆盖的该文件。这两个文件都保存在C盘的根目录下,不过他们有默认的隐含、系统和只读属性,因此你不能用一般的方法替换,而首先要解除他们的隐含、系统和只读属性。方法是这样的:进入到Windows2000中,在运行中分别输入attribc:ntldrsrhattribc:srh每行输入完成后按下回车键。这时你已经完全的解除了这两个文件的系统、隐含和只读属性。现在从WindowsXP的安装光盘的I386文件夹中复制这两个同名的文件出来到C盘根目录,并覆盖原文件。这时你的双启动菜单就已经恢复了。不过安全起见我们可以把那两个文件隐藏起来,方法是,在运行中分别输入:attribc:ntldr+s+r+hattribc:+s+r+h这样会重新赋予那两个文件系统、隐含和只读属性。重启动一下看看吧,你的双启动菜单已经完全正常了在XP系统下安装成为XP-2000双系统 在XP系统下安装成为XP-2000双系统 副标题: 一、前提条件 必须有FAT32(或FAT)文件系统格式的活动分区和有一个FAT32(或FAT)文件系统格式的分区用于安装Windows2000系统。在WindowsXP系统查看硬盘各分区的文件系统格式的方法右键点击“我的电脑”-管理-磁盘管理,在这里可清楚的看到各分区的文件系统格式。二、安装Windows2000系统 一般安装双操作系统的顺序为先装低版本的Windows再装高版本的Windows最后装Linux即由95-98-Me-2000-XP-2003-Linux系统。 我们要在XP系统中安装98成为XP-98双系统时,在XP系统中直接安装98是不行的。必须在DOS下或用光盘启动Windows98安装,关于98系统的详细安装方法点击以下链接查看 如何在DOS下安装Windows2000 /Article/Class2/Class11/200501/4058.html 或者Windows98光盘启动安装过程详细图解: /Article/Class2/Class7/200501/4062.html 在XP系统中安装2000成为XP-2000双系统时,在安装2000的过程中关键要注意的地方在DOS下或用光盘启动Windows2000安装后,到选择安装目录时, 图2中选择安装目录。Windows系统不主张在同一个分区安装双系统,因为C盘已经安装了XP系统,所以这里只能把2000安装在其它盘,这里我们选D盘。用鼠标点击“其它目录”使其被选中,然后点击“下一步” 默认的安装目录为“C:WINDOWS.000”(因安装程序检测到C盘已经有操作系统的存在,故将WINDOWS变为WINDOWS.000)这里要将2000安装在D盘,因些将“C:WINDOWS.000”改为“D:WINDOWS”,如下图4所示。 改变安装目录为“D:WINDOWS”后点击“下一步”继续安装,其余过程与正常安装2000没有分别。安装完成后直接重启进入了2000系统,没有双系统启动菜单出现,暂时不能进入XP系统,需要修复启动菜单才行。 三、修复双系统启动菜单 1、用XP安装程序加载启动菜单进入Windows2000系统,将XP安装光盘放入光驱中(或者找到XP安装文件所在的目录后双击setup.exe)将自动启动XP安装程序, 点击“安装MicrosoftWindowsXP”,这里要注意了,安装类型一定要选“全新安装”,点击“安装类型”右侧的三角型符号,在弹出的下拉菜单中选择“全新安装”,。点击“下一步”,接着继续安装许可协议提示、输入序列号、检查磁盘、提示是否下载升级安装文件、复制启动所需文件等等过后,在系统第一次重启时取出光盘(否则不能正常启动),第一次重启时将会有启动选择菜单。 这是关键步骤,第一次重启时显示启动选择菜单时间为5秒,这里用向上方向键选择第一项“MicrosoftWindowsXPProfessional”后回车,即可进入C盘的XP系统,2、清理安装程序留下的临时文件进入XP系统后,打开我的电脑,打开C盘,删除以$开头和以$结尾的所有文件夹和文件($WIN-NT$、$LDR$),这些是安装程序留下的,已经没有用了。 3、修改启动菜单然后点击开始-指向所有程序-附件-记事本,点击记事本,即可启动记事本程序,。 点击“文件”-打开,调出打开文件窗口, 启动菜单文件位于C盘根目录下。因此在打开文件窗口中点击“我的电脑”,然后在主窗口中双击“本地磁盘C”,这样在主窗口中即列出了C盘根目录下的所有目录和文本文档 在图12中并没有列出启动文件BOOT.ini,原因是它不是目录或文本文档。要列出C盘根目录的所有目录及文件,必须在打开窗口下方点击“文件类型”右侧的箭头后选择所有文件。 这时在主窗口中即可见到BOOT文件了,点击“BOOT”文件选中它,即可自动在“文件名”输入栏输入该文件名(如果BOOT文件已设为隐藏时,可直接在“文件名”右侧的输入框中直接输入“BOOT.INI”), 然后点击“打开”按钮即可用记事本打开BOOT文件。如下图15所示。BOOT.INI文件的内容如下bootloader timeout=5 default=C:$WIN_NT$.BTBOOTSECT.DAT operatingsystems multi(0)disk(0)rdisk(0)partition(1)WINDOWS=MicrosoftWindowsXPProfessional/fastdetect C:$WIN_NT$.BTBOOTSECT.DAT=MicrosoftWindowsXPProfessional安装程序 D:=MicrosoftWindows 在这里将BOOT.INI文件的内容改为如下 bootloader timeout=30 default=multi(0)disk(0)rdisk(0)partition(1)WINDOWS operatingsystems multi(0)disk(0)rdisk(0)partition(1)WINDOWS=MicrosoftWindowsXPProfessional/fastdetect D:=MicrosoftWindows2000 然后点击记事本菜单栏的“文件”,在弹出的下拉菜单中指向“保存”。 点击“保存”即可将改动后的内容保存并关闭记事本窗口,至此启动菜单已修改完成。重新启动后将出现如下图18所示的启动菜单选择屏幕。至此在XP系统安装2000系统,成为XP-2000双系统已经完成。系统的安装 一、安装Windows 2000相信许多朋友都安装过Windows 2000,对其安装过程应该不会太陌生。下面是我在安装双系统时总结的一些小经验,可能会让您在安装过程中少走些弯路。1、安装Windows 2000 用Windows 2000的安装光盘引导系统,安装过程中选择安装到C盘,并且选择“使用NTFS格式格式化硬盘”,以后根据屏幕提示即可完成安装。Windows 2000安装完毕,可以在资源管理器中把E、F、G分区格式化成NTFS,D分区可以在安装Windows XP的时候格式化成NTFS;图1 更改系统变量的路径2、修改环境变量 先在G盘建立一个名为Temporary的文件夹,然后右键单击“我的电脑属性高级环境变量”,把当前用户的用户变量TEMP和TMP都修改为G:Temporary,然后把下面系统变量中的TEMP和TMP也改为G:Temporary(如图1),修改完毕单击“确定”。然后单击“高级”选项卡中的性能选项,单击“虚拟内存”组合框中的“更改”按钮,把默认的C盘中的初始大小和最大值都删除,单击右侧的“设置”按钮,然后拖动滚动条,选择G盘,把初始大小和最大值都改为288MB,同样单击“设置”,修改完毕依次单击“确定”关闭所有的选项卡,重启计算机以后就可以把页面文件挪到G分区了。这样做的目的主要是尽量避免磁盘碎片的产生,另外,清理系统的临时文件也很方便,只要把G:Temporary中的所有文件删除就可以了;3、修改IE浏览器的缓存 在桌面上右击IE的图标,选择“属性”,单击“设置”按钮,把IE的缓存移动到G盘;4、添加用户 通过“控制面板用户和密码”为其他家庭成员建立登录账号,建议各成员都为Power User组中的用户。然后按照第二步的操作,用每个账号登录系统,把用户变量中的TEMP和TMP都改为G:Temporary。同样根据第三步的操作,把当前用户的IE缓存挪到G盘;图2 更改我的文档的目标文件夹5、修改“我的文档”文件夹的位置 右键单击“我的文档”图标,选择“属性”,把“目标文件夹”的位置修改为F盘的某个文件夹,比如“F:Documents and Settings当前登录的用户名My Documents”(如图2)。然后以其他用户登录,按照此方法设置;6、安装硬件驱动7、建立上网账号至此,最基本的Windows 2000已经安装完毕,下面该安装Windows XP了。二、安装Windows XPWindows XP的安装跟Windows 2000的安装差不多,只需安装到D盘,并且选择“用NTFS文件系统格式化硬盘”就好了。Windows XP安装完毕会自动生成一个双启动菜单,开机时可以用该菜单决定用哪个系统引导。其他的步骤跟Windows 2000差不多,也就是修改环境变量,如TEMP和TMP同样设置为G:Temporary,IE的缓存挪到G盘等。因为Windows XP主要用来做家庭娱乐用的多媒体平台,所以建议把Windows XP作为公用的操作系统,不必为每个家庭成员都建立登录账号。三、双系统维护至此,两个系统都完成了基本安装,下面要做的就是对系统作备份了。考虑到Windows 2000是主要的操作系统,安装的软件多了难免会出问题。所以最好对整个C分区用Ghost作备份。首先要有Ghost软件,版本越高越好,如Ghost 2002(低版本的Ghost无法备份NTFS分区),在Windows 2000或者Windows XP系统中把Ghost的全部文件拷贝到H:Ghost目录中,然后用Windows 98的启动盘引导机器(需要在BIOS中设置为从A盘引导),由于DOS系统无法识别前五个NTFS分区,所以这时H盘的盘符变成C,在命令行方式下键入CD C:ghost,然后启动Ghost 2002,就可以在Ghost的分区选择窗口里看到全部的6个分区了。我们只选择C分区作备份即可,把GHO文件保存到H盘。以后Windows 2000出了问题,可以用Ghost快速的恢复了(建议先整理C盘的碎片再用Ghost作备份)。由于Windows XP只作为家庭娱乐平台,系统出问题的概率自然比较小。况且Windows XP占用的硬盘空间太大,用Ghost作备份也不是太划算,只要利用系统还原功能多创建几个还原点就可以了。另外,还需要备份C盘根目录下的boot.ini,,ntldr这三个文件。这些文件跟双启动菜单有关。如果因为某种原因丢失了双启动菜单,那就利用能启动的那个系统引导机器,把这三个文件拷贝到C盘根目录就可以找回双启动菜单了。如果因为某种原因造成双系统都无法启动(这种概率发生的可能几乎为零,除非硬盘物理损坏),可以用Windows 20

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论